Round, Princess and Fancy Shapes
A great place to start when searching for a 3-carat diamond is considering the desired appearance of your ring. Diamond shapes are determined primarily by personal preference and style, but their size appearance also differs. For example, a 3 carat diamond with a fancy shape (like an oval or marquise) will appear larger due to its elongated design.
Next, you will want to consider the color and clarity of your diamond. Higher grades of both can be more expensive, but an eye-clean diamond with a color grade in the G-H range and a clarity grade in the VS1-VS2 range can still offer a high degree of brilliance for a much more affordable price. Finally, be sure to prioritize the cut quality of your diamond, as this can have a significant impact on a diamond’s overall appearance and value. A well-cut diamond will accentuate the sparkle and visual appeal of any shape, and it can help compensate for lower grades in color or clarity.
